For fourteen years, As-Suwayda in southern Syria stood apart from the country’s devastating civil war, its streets largely untouched by destruction. That fragile calm collapsed in mid-July 2025.

What began as an ordinary day spiraled into sudden armed clashes. At the city’s gates, regime-affiliated forces advanced with armored vehicles and snipers took positions overlooking the neighborhoods. Inside, Druze militias mobilized hastily while checkpoints emerged to halt Bedouin tribal incursions, turning once-quiet streets into contested frontlines.

The fighting scarred the city: empty roads, charred buildings, and families caught between shifting lines of fire. Beyond the battles, a humanitarian crisis quickly unfolded. Bedouin families, facing both violence and threats of deportation, joined thousands of displaced residents seeking refuge in temporary shelters.

This photographic series follows that abrupt descent from the arrival of armed convoys and tense defensive preparations, through the street battles and visible scars of destruction, to the mass evacuations that revealed the human cost of Suwayda’s sudden war.
